Insurance Provider Directories

Many health insurance providers offer directories that list chiropractors who are covered under their plans. These directories are often accessible online, allowing individuals to search for practitioners by location, specialty, and availability. Users can filter results based on their specific insurance policy, ensuring that they find a chiropractor who will reduce out-of-pocket expenses. Some directories may also include reviews or ratings from other patients, adding an extra layer of insight.

It's crucial to stay informed about the terms of your health fund when utilising these directories. Coverage policies can vary significantly among insurers and even among different policies within the same company. Familiarising yourself with the specifics of your plan, such as co-payments or referral requirements, can help streamline the process of finding and connecting with a chiropractor. This ensures you make the most of your benefits while receiving the care you need.

Health funds often maintain comprehensive directories that showcase their listed chiropractors. Accessing these directories can help you identify practitioners who accept your insurance coverage. Many health funds provide online portals that allow you to filter results based on your location and specific needs. This can save you time and ensure that you find a chiropractor who is well-suited to your requirements.

In addition to online resources, you can also contact your health fund directly. Customer service representatives can offer insights and recommendations tailored to your situation. Engaging in this dialogue may uncover options that are not readily available online. It's also a chance to ask about any referral requirements or limits on services that your plan may impose.

University and College Clinics

Many universities and colleges with chiropractic programs offer clinic services to the public. These clinics are often staffed by students under the supervision of experienced practitioners, providing an opportunity for affordable care. Patients benefit from the latest techniques and approaches taught in academic settings. Accessing these services is a practical way to receive treatment while supporting the education of future chiropractors.

In addition to affordability, visiting a university clinic can provide insights into the field of chiropractic care. Patients may encounter newer therapeutic practices and a thorough approach to patient care. Engaging with students and faculty can enhance the overall experience, allowing for deeper discussions about health and wellness. Such interactions often foster a sense of community between educators and patients, creating a positive environment for healing.

Accessing Services from Chiropractic Schools

Chiropractic schools often have clinics that offer services to the public at reduced rates. Students under supervision provide treatments, which allows them to gain practical experience while ensuring that patients receive quality care. This can be an excellent option for those looking for affordable chiropractic services without compromising on standards.

Many chiropractic institutions also have community outreach programmes aimed at raising awareness about spinal health and wellness. These initiatives not only enhance the educational experience for students but also serve as a resource for locals seeking assistance. Engaging with these programmes can help individuals learn more about chiropractic care and find practitioners aligned with their health needs.

Local Chambers of Commerce

Local chambers of commerce serve as valuable hubs for local business information, including health services like chiropractic care. These organisations often maintain directories or lists of their member businesses, which may feature licensed chiropractors in the area. By reaching out to your local chamber, you can gain insights into reputable practices and any specialised services they might offer.

Chambers frequently conduct networking events and community fairs, presenting an excellent opportunity for personal connections with local chiropractors. Attending these events allows individuals to learn more about different practitioners, hear testimonials from community members, and even access exclusive promotions. Engaging with the chamber can provide a wealth of knowledge about local healthcare options and foster relationships with trusted professionals.

Discovering Chiropractors through Business Networks

Many local chambers of commerce maintain directories that list various businesses, including health services. These resources can be invaluable for people seeking chiropractors in their area. Members of the chamber often engage in networking events, which can provide opportunities to meet practitioners personally and ask about their specialties or treatment approaches.

In addition, local business groups can serve as platforms where members recommend trusted services. Engaging with these networks often leads to insights about reputable chiropractors highly regarded by other local businesses. Word-of-mouth recommendations can help narrow down choices, giving potential patients an added layer of confidence in their decisions.

How can I find chiropractors covered by my insurance?

You can check your insurance provider's directory, which typically lists in-network chiropractors. Additionally, contacting your health fund directly can provide you with a more comprehensive list of covered services.

Are university and college chiropractic clinics open to the public?

Yes, many chiropractic schools offer services to the public at reduced rates. It’s advisable to contact the clinic directly to confirm availability and any requirements for new patients.

What should I expect during my first visit to a chiropractic clinic?

During your first visit, the chiropractor will conduct an assessment, which may include a physical examination and a discussion of your medical history. This helps them develop a tailored treatment plan for you.

How can local chambers of commerce assist me in finding a chiropractor?

Local chambers of commerce often have directories of businesses in the area, including healthcare providers like chiropractors. They may also provide referrals or recommendations based on business member networks.

Are there any online resources to help locate chiropractors in my area?

Yes, numerous online platforms and directories exist to help you find chiropractors near you. Websites like HealthEngine, Whitepages, and local business listings can be helpful in your search.
